Using on a Cooking Heater
• Be sure to wipe any water droplets off the underside of the product
before placing it on the heater to ensure efficient heating.
• Place the product at the center of the heater.
• A humming noise may occur when heating the product on an IH
heater. This is caused by vibrations of the heater resonating through
the product, and is not a defect.
• Do not use the product if it is deformed or rattles due to being
dropped, or if holes have appeared.
* Use the product correctly in accordance with the cooking heater instruction
manual.
Using on a Gas Cooker
GAS
• Do not use the product to boil a small amount of water. Parts that do
not contain water may overheat and discolor.
• Adjust the size of the flame so that the flame does not spread
to the sides of the product. Doing so may cause the handle or lid
knob to become hot, resulting in deterioration or discoloration.
• Place the product at the center of the cooktop to ensure stability.
Preparation Before Use
• Wash the product using a sponge and neutral detergent two or three
times before using for the first time.
• Next, boil and throw away water once or twice.
• Do not use chlorine bleach on the product.
• Remove any stickers that are attached to the product before use.
Care After Use
• Wash with a sponge, etc. after use, wipe off any water and allow the
product to dry before storage.
• Dirt that contains salt or oil on the product may cause rust. Be sure
to keep the product clean.
• Storing the product in contact with other types of metal such as steel
or aluminum may cause the product to rust.
• If rust occurs, remove the rust using a cream cleaner and sponge,
etc., and then rinse thoroughly.
• White spots may appear on the bottom of the product through
continued use. These are caused by magnesium or calcium residue
from tap water. They are not harmful to health. White spots may
appear on the body, lid or spout of the product. Wash thoroughly
after use.
